wlan:Check priviledge permission before processing SET_VAR_GET_NONE IOCTL

Kernel assumes all SET IOCTL commands are assigned with even
numbers. But in our WLAN driver, some SET IOCTLS are assigned with
odd numbers. This leads kernel fail to check, for some SET IOCTLs,
whether user has the right permission to do SET operation.
Hence, in driver, before processing SET_VAR_GET_NONE IOCTL, making
sure user task has right permission to process the command.
